Abstract

(GaIn)2O3 (IGO) films with a Ga content of about 30% were deposited on sapphire substrates by magnetron sputtering followed by thermal annealing. Annealing temperatures from 600°C to 1000°C showed little influence on the structural and optical properties of the films. All the films showed smooth surfaces and high transmittances in the visible range. X-ray diffraction patterns identified the mixed phase structure of the obtained films. Only one absorption edge was identified for all the films, suggesting these films are suitable for fabricating high responsivity ultraviolet detectors.
